Vitamin C deficiency occurs primarily in malnourished adults. In extreme cases, scurvy can develop, characterized by weakness, anemia, bruising, bleeding, and loose teeth. Vitamin C is necessary for the growth, development, and repair of all body tissues. It may reduce the duration and severity of cold symptoms.

Eating is the best way to get all the nutrients. Eating fruits, vegetables, and other products provide vitamin C, as well as various vitamins, minerals, and fiber.

The best sources of vitamin C are fruits such as oranges, strawberries, kiwis, and honeydew melons, and vegetables such as peppers, spinach, tomatoes, broccoli, and Brussels sprouts.
